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
296757 9748 4706334 227530807
97634 890822705 8765443199
97634 890822705 8765443199
2738855 6373 5540793019 10332446686 626823700
All about undefined
Interested in learning more?
97634 890822705 8765443199
2738855 6373 5540793019 10332446686 626823700
See more
74045 96188605169 30
9948 47 85546585505
See more
27093642348 85862737133 49
8363 55355 800
See more